Mission Objectives

The KiwiMars 2012 Project has two major components:

KiwiMars Expedition

A crew of six will live and work at the Mars Desert Research Station for a period of two weeks, from 22 April to 6 May 2012 (NZST). They will strictly follow the site protocols which help emulate the working and living conditions of a real Mars-base, as they perform science, research and exploration tasks; and communicate with educators and students 'back on Earth'

KiwiMars Outreach

Commencing ahead of the expedition will be an education and outreach programme.
